Review Request: Simplify layout of popup window to allow it grow when a new stream is added

Christian Esken esken at kde.org
Wed Jan 2 20:35:13 GMT 2013



> On Jan. 2, 2013, 7:11 p.m., Christian Esken wrote:
> > I do not see any changes about resizing the Sound Menu.
> >  - With ALSA + MPRIS2 it worked before and after the patch
> >  - With Pulseaudio it neither works before or after the patch
> >
> 
> Eugene Shalygin wrote:
>     Thank you for the test. I'm confused. I have 4 patches applied to KMix right now and the popup window grows and shrinks. Will compile it with the this one only and check in a few moments
> 
> Eugene Shalygin wrote:
>     Christian,
>     
>     I've applied this patch and my patch from https://bugs.kde.org/show_bug.cgi?id=288637 (to see new pulseaudio streams) and it works.
>     Obviously, without the patch from bugzilla I did not see new streams at all. With the path from bugzilla only, new streams are added, but the poup window retains its size.
>     
>     Sory, I can not test ALSA/MPRIS2 case.
> 
> Christian Esken wrote:
>     I should probably add that that is basically a good thing. It does not break that functionality. If the rest of the tests are OK and it fixes the crash we are probably good to go.

Thanks for testing.
Ah, you have more patches. Yes, I can confirm from looking at your patch from https://bugs.kde.org/show_bug.cgi?id=288637 will make it work. In the meantime I did a full patch that also fixes the logig  for capture streams. I will commit it in the next couple of minutes.
Interestingly enough growing and shrinking also works (for me) without the patch from review 107822.


- Christian


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
http://git.reviewboard.kde.org/r/107822/#review24483
-----------------------------------------------------------


On Dec. 20, 2012, 8:20 p.m., Eugene Shalygin wrote:
> 
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> http://git.reviewboard.kde.org/r/107822/
> -----------------------------------------------------------
> 
> (Updated Dec. 20, 2012, 8:20 p.m.)
> 
> 
> Review request for KDE Multimedia and Christian Esken.
> 
> 
> Description
> -------
> 
> Eliminate QWidgetAction from popup window that allows popup window to change its size. For instance, when a new stream is added, it grows now.
> 
> This might help to avoid recreation of the View (http://commits.kde.org/kmix/1dfbbeb37fe03ed58b7be8ecdf22b376e3633830) that in turn might help with https://bugs.kde.org/show_bug.cgi?id=311167 ?
> 
> 
> This addresses bug 288637.
>     http://bugs.kde.org/show_bug.cgi?id=288637
> 
> 
> Diffs
> -----
> 
>   gui/kmixdockwidget.h 0109086 
>   gui/kmixdockwidget.cpp 3bda22e 
> 
> Diff: http://git.reviewboard.kde.org/r/107822/diff/
> 
> 
> Testing
> -------
> 
> Manual
> 
> 
> Thanks,
> 
> Eugene Shalygin
> 
>

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/kde-multimedia/attachments/20130102/5887b91c/attachment.htm>
-------------- next part --------------
_______________________________________________
kde-multimedia mailing list
kde-multimedia at kde.org
https://mail.kde.org/mailman/listinfo/kde-multimedia


More information about the kde-multimedia mailing list